If your company is being inundated with resumes from job seekers, like many throughout the country currently are, you may want to consider implementing some type of Web-based staffing software solution.
Web-based staffing software uses artificial intelligence and resume tracking software to collect, sort through and rank large amounts of resumes and candidate information. That information is then turned over to hiring managers and recruiters so they can more easily and efficiently select the right person for the job.
